use assert[Not]In where appropriate
diff --git a/Lib/test/test_zipfile.py b/Lib/test/test_zipfile.py
index 27591b7..cd954f9 100644
--- a/Lib/test/test_zipfile.py
+++ b/Lib/test/test_zipfile.py
@@ -68,9 +68,9 @@
             lines = directory.splitlines()
             self.assertEqual(len(lines), 4) # Number of files + header
 
-            self.assertTrue('File Name' in lines[0])
-            self.assertTrue('Modified' in lines[0])
-            self.assertTrue('Size' in lines[0])
+            self.assertIn('File Name', lines[0])
+            self.assertIn('Modified', lines[0])
+            self.assertIn('Size', lines[0])
 
             fn, date, time_, size = lines[1].split()
             self.assertEqual(fn, 'another.name')
